Six from Celina arrested in drug raid
CELINA - Six people were arrested by the Mercer County Sheriff's Office on Tuesday on drug charges.
The arrests were part of an effort by the Grand Lake Drug Task Force.
Amber N. Mott, 28, of Celina, was charged with two counts of trafficking in drugs (marijuana), both fourth-degree felonies.
Diana Oehler, 56, of Celina, was charged with one count of trafficking in drugs (cocaine), a fourth-degree felony.
James T. Oehler, 63, of Celina, was charged with three counts of trafficking in drugs (cocaine), all fourth-degree felonies.
Kevin R. Owens, 45, of Celina, was charged with three counts of trafficking in drugs (cocaine), with two as fourth-degree felonies and one as a fifth-degree felony.
Douglas E. Spry, 49, of Celina, was charged with one count of trafficking in drugs (cocaine), a fourth-degree felony.
Olaf Thompson III, 51, of Celina, was charged with four counts of trafficking in drugs (cocaine), three are fifth-degree felonies, one isa fourth-degree felony.
